Features and commands
Feature/Command | Description |
---|---|
generateByProductOrService | This command generates a landing page based on a given product, service, or business name. You can also provide SEO keywords for optimization and a list of features or characteristics to highlight. The output is provided in Markdown format. |
generateByUrl | This command creates a landing page from a web URL. The URL should be provided as a parameter, and the output will be in Markdown format. The process typically completes in about a minute. |
previewLandingPage | This command allows you to preview the content generated by the landing page after using the generateByUrl or generateByProductOrService command. You need to provide the job ID returned by the generation command. If the return is empty, prompt the user to try again in about a minute. If the editLandingPageUrl field is not empty, the user can enter it to edit. |
publishLandingPage | This command publishes the landing page to an online URL. You need to provide the job ID returned by the generation command. Prompt the user with the message: "If the preview results meet your requirements, you can request to publish using the prompt word to see the final effect on the online URL". |
publishedUrl | This command returns a publicly accessible online URL for the published landing page. Call this command after using the publishLandingPage command. If the return is empty, prominently prompt the user to try again in about a minute. |
